A WOMAN was left with 'serious' injuries after she was attacked by a man.

She was taken to hospital where she remains, eleven days after the fight.

The two began to argue in Lorne Street at around 4.30am on Sunday, May 14.

A fight broke out and the woman, aged in her 30s, fell into the road.

She was rushed to the Royal Berkshire Hospital by an ambulance.

Investigating officer Detective Constable Marius York of Reading CID said: "We are appealing for witnesses or information to the incident, which has left a woman in hospital with very serious injuries.

"A thorough investigation is underway to establish the exact circumstances of what took place, and we would urge anyone who witnessed it to please come forward.
